        <![CDATA[ Here is a tutorial on making a flemish bowstring.I don't own a jig so I use my workbench. I put two nails in the bench as pegs, 6 to 8 inches longer at each end of the bow than the bow knocks I am going to make the string for.I then choose 2 different colors of B50 Dacron string material to use in the string. for this example we are using green and yellow.  I use 12 strands for any bow up to 70lbs, 16 strands for 70-80lbs and I haven't made any strings for higher poundages.I tie the first... ]]>
